What you should know
The Motion Planning AI Engineer landscape in Dallas is not what most salary sites will tell you. Dallas is a major corporate hub with dozens of Fortune 500 headquarters spanning telecom, finance, defense, and retail. The metro's low cost of living and no state income tax make it a magnet for corporate relocations. Tech salaries in Dallas have risen quickly, particularly in fintech, cybersecurity, and enterprise software. Deep expertise in trajectory optimization, sampling based planning, and learned planning algorithms drives top compensation. Engineers who can design motion planners that handle dynamic environments with safety constraints in real time are extremely valued. Experience with manipulation planning, multi agent coordination, and formal safety guarantees adds significant salary premiums.
Junior motion planning engineers start at $108,000 to $140,000. Mid level engineers with real robot deployment experience earn $158,000 to $200,000. Senior engineers reach $205,000 to $258,000. Principal planning scientists at autonomous vehicle or robotics companies can exceed $340,000 in total compensation. In Dallas, cost of living sits near the national average, so the numbers you see are roughly what you keep.
Base salary is not the full picture. Equity at robotics and autonomous systems companies adds 20 to 40% of total compensation. Performance bonuses of 15 to 25% are standard. Signing bonuses of $25,000 to $60,000 are common. Benefits frequently include hardware lab time and research conference travel budgets. And on the tax side: texas levies no state income tax, giving Dallas workers a meaningful take home pay advantage. Local property taxes are above the national average, typically around 2% of assessed value. When someone quotes you $175,000, ask what the total package looks like.
